Securing Prescription Pain Meds in Canada
Navigating the landscape of prescription pain medication in Canada can seem daunting. While obtaining these medications is achievable, it's important to understand the guidelines and process. First, consult with a qualified medical professional who can analyze your pain intensity and determine if prescription medication is the appropriate option.
If deemed necessary, your doctor will issue a prescription for the specific medication they believe will be most effective for your situation. This order must then be processed at a licensed pharmacy.
It's important to note that pharmacies in Canada are strictly regulated and follow with all federal and provincial regulations. They will verify your prescription and provide the medication according to your doctor's recommendations.
When filling your prescription, be prepared to present valid identification. Additionally, pharmacies may require information about any other medications you are currently taking, as well as any allergies or medical conditions you have.
